Abstract:
The present invention relates to a transmission of information in a wireless communication network between a radio access node and a relay node, wherein, according to a new ground rule, for each allocated downlink subframe for a downlink transmission from the access node to the relay node, an uplink transmission subframe for an uplink transmission is allocated four transmission time intervals later. A downlink subframe is only allocated when a further subframe of the same transmission time interval for a transmission from the relay node to the user equipment is a subframe of a type that indicates to a user equipment that no data are received beyond a control region of the subframe.
